RTS.FM Bucharest 3 Years Anniversary @ Club EDEN
RTS.FM is the first international internet radio project with Live audiovisual broadcasting from 13+ studios around the world. RTS.FM celebrates… Read More »RTS.FM Bucharest 3 Years Anniversary @ Club EDEN